Germany set to blame Russia for airport explosive-laden drone incident

Summary

Germany is expected to formally accuse Russia of being behind a drone incident at a strategic airport near Leipzig on the night of August 4-5. One of the drones involved was found to be carrying explosives, and German officials are blaming a Russian intelligence service for the attack.

Key Facts

  • The incident happened at a strategic airport near Leipzig, Germany, on August 4-5, 2026.
  • Drones involved in the incident included at least one carrying explosives.
  • Germany’s Foreign Minister Johann Wadephul and Interior Minister Alexander Dobrindt will officially blame Russia.
  • This would be the first time Germany formally accuses Russia of such an attack with drones.
  • German authorities suspect a Russian intelligence service is responsible.
  • The event raises concerns about security at key infrastructure sites in Europe.
  • The accusation occurs amid wider tensions between Germany (and Europe) and Russia.
